Description
Daily and hourly station-based Fire Weather Index calculations over the Western US. The main source of station data is the NOAA NCEI Integrated Surface Database (ISD)

Any additional info you think is relevant, possibly including spatial or temporal subset if applicable?
The first of several Vector (Point) datasets in CSV format.
As determined in discussions on https://github.com/MAAP-Project/Community/issues/767
- Import into STAC (needs an ongoing pipeline that detects new uploads to the bucket)
- Expose s3 prefix as public and/or import to Fire features API https://firenrt.delta-backend.com/
2a. If using the Features API, please support "format=csv" for the Matlab users of this data. Ideally the original filename can be used as a filter too.
